Back to Glossary

What is Azure Cloud Computing?

Azure refers to a comprehensive set of cloud computing services offered by Microsoft, designed to help organizations build, deploy, and manage applications through a global network of data centers. It provides a wide range of services, including compute, storage, networking, and artificial intelligence, allowing businesses to scale and grow efficiently.

Azure enables users to choose from a variety of services to develop and deploy applications, including Virtual Machines, App Service, and Azure Functions. Additionally, it offers a secure and reliable platform for storing and managing data, with services like Azure Storage and Azure Cosmos DB.

The Comprehensive Guide to Azure: Unlocking the Power of Cloud Computing

Azure is a game-changing platform that has revolutionized the way businesses and organizations approach cloud computing. As a comprehensive set of cloud services offered by Microsoft, Azure provides a wide range of tools and features that enable users to build, deploy, and manage applications with ease. With its global network of data centers, Azure offers a secure, reliable, and scalable platform for businesses to grow and thrive in the digital age.

At its core, Azure is designed to provide users with a flexible and scalable platform for developing and deploying applications. With a variety of services to choose from, including Virtual Machines, App Service, and Azure Functions, users can select the services that best fit their needs and goals. Additionally, Azure offers a secure and reliable platform for storing and managing data, with services like Azure Storage and Azure Cosmos DB.

Key Features and Benefits of Azure

Azure offers a wide range of features and benefits that make it an attractive platform for businesses and organizations. Some of the key features and benefits of Azure include:

  • Scalability: Azure provides a scalable platform that allows businesses to quickly scale up or down to meet changing demands.

  • Flexibility: With a variety of services to choose from, Azure provides users with the flexibility to select the services that best fit their needs and goals.

  • Security: Azure provides a secure platform for storing and managing data, with advanced security features like encryption, firewalls, and access controls.

  • Reliability: Azure offers a reliable platform that is designed to minimize downtime and ensure high availability.

  • Cost-Effectiveness: Azure provides a cost-effective platform that allows businesses to reduce their capital expenditures and operating expenses.

In addition to these features and benefits, Azure also provides a wide range of tools and services that enable users to build, deploy, and manage applications with ease. Some of these tools and services include:

  • Azure DevOps: A set of services that enable users to plan, develop, deliver, and operate software in a collaborative and efficient manner.

  • Azure Monitor: A service that provides users with real-time monitoring and analytics capabilities to help them optimize the performance and availability of their applications.

  • Azure Security Center: A service that provides users with advanced security features and capabilities to help them protect their applications and data from cyber threats.

Azure Services: A Comprehensive Overview

Azure offers a wide range of services that enable users to build, deploy, and manage applications with ease. Some of the most popular Azure services include:

  • Virtual Machines: A service that enables users to create and manage virtual machines in the cloud.

  • App Service: A service that enables users to build, deploy, and manage web applications.

  • Azure Functions: A service that enables users to build, deploy, and manage serverless applications.

  • Azure Storage: A service that enables users to store and manage data in the cloud.

  • Azure Cosmos DB: A service that enables users to store and manage data in a globally distributed database.

Each of these services provides a unique set of features and benefits that enable users to build, deploy, and manage applications with ease. By selecting the services that best fit their needs and goals, users can create a customized platform that meets their specific requirements.

Real-World Applications of Azure

Azure has a wide range of real-world applications that demonstrate its power and versatility. Some examples of real-world applications of Azure include:

  • Web Development: Azure can be used to build and deploy web applications, such as e-commerce platforms, social media sites, and online forums.

  • Mobile App Development: Azure can be used to build and deploy mobile applications, such as games, productivity apps, and social media apps.

  • IoT Development: Azure can be used to build and deploy IoT applications, such as smart home devices, industrial sensors, and wearable devices.

  • Machine Learning: Azure can be used to build and deploy machine learning models, such as predictive analytics, natural language processing, and computer vision.

  • Data Analytics: Azure can be used to build and deploy data analytics platforms, such as data warehousing, business intelligence, and data visualization.

These are just a few examples of the many real-world applications of Azure. By providing a comprehensive set of cloud services, Azure enables users to build, deploy, and manage applications with ease, and to create innovative solutions that transform businesses and industries.

Best Practices for Using Azure

To get the most out of Azure, it's essential to follow best practices that ensure security, scalability, and reliability. Some best practices for using Azure include:

  • Use Secure Authentication: Use secure authentication methods, such as Azure Active Directory, to protect access to Azure resources.

  • Monitor and Analyze Performance: Use Azure Monitor and Azure Analytics to monitor and analyze the performance of Azure resources.

  • Use Scalable Resources: Use scalable resources, such as Azure Virtual Machines and Azure App Service, to ensure that applications can scale to meet changing demands.

  • Follow Security Guidelines: Follow security guidelines, such as encrypting data and using firewalls, to protect Azure resources from cyber threats.

  • Use Cost-Effective Resources: Use cost-effective resources, such as Azure Storage and Azure Cosmos DB, to reduce costs and optimize resource utilization.

By following these best practices, users can ensure that their Azure resources are secure, scalable, and reliable, and that they get the most out of their investment in Azure.

Conclusion

In conclusion, Azure is a powerful and versatile platform that enables users to build, deploy, and manage applications with ease. With its comprehensive set of cloud services, Azure provides a secure, reliable, and scalable platform for businesses to grow and thrive in the digital age. By following best practices and using Azure services effectively, users can create innovative solutions that transform businesses and industries, and that drive success and growth in the cloud.

Whether you're a developer, an IT professional, or a business leader, Azure has something to offer. With its wide range of services and features, Azure provides a comprehensive platform that meets the needs of businesses and organizations of all sizes and types. So why not get started with Azure today, and discover the power and versatility of the cloud for yourself?